(Submitted: Rudi Fowler) A New Brunswick-based international snowmobile challenge looks to raise money for local summer camps. From Feb. 16 to Feb. 20, the sixth-annual 1000 Mile Challenge saw teams from across the country and the eastern United States travel across the province.
